BioBag is the world’s largest brand of certified bio-degradable and compostable bags and films made from the material, Mater-Bi.  The Mater-Bi process is protected by more than 70 patents.
BioBag products are certified by the Biodegradable Products Institute to meet the ASTM D6400-04 standard for biodegradable and compostable plastic.
BioBag products meet the California Law, which makes the ASTM specifications the legal standard for biodegradable and compostable product claims.
BioBag products use no polyethylene in the production process. BioBags are made from plant starches, biodegradable polymer and other renewable resources.
BioBag products breathe, allowing heat and moisture to escape, thus reducing odor and water-weight.
BioBag products are DEN certified for restricted use of metals in our inks and dyes.
BioBag products are GMO FREE and Debio certified for use in organic farming.
BioBag offers the widest variety of BPI certified biodegradable bags, liners and films in the market today and has been doing so since 1994.
BioBag products decompose in 10 to 40 days in a municipal composting environment.
BioBags are shelf stable. For best results, consumers should use BioBags within 12 months of purchase.
BioBags are manufactured in Norway, Belgium and the United States.
BioBags are not meant to contain hot liquids.
Support and encourage composting in your area - Approximately 30% of landfill waste is organic waste.
This organic waste creates methane gas (bad greenhouse gas). By diverting organic waste from the landfill and composting it, we can reduce greenhouse gases and create nutrient rich top soils for agriculture thus reducing the need for petroleum based fertilizers.
